Gay Catholic Bishops ’ Conference of the Philippines (CBCP) CBCP is the Episcopal Conference of the Philippines‚ and as such is the official organization of the Catholic episcopacy and what is commonly referred to as the Philippine Catholic. The CBCP is made up of 99 active and 32 honorary bishops and other members. Its main office building is centrally located within the Intramuros district‚ located just behind the Manila Cathedral.     Barong Tagalog From Wikipedia‚ the free encyclopedia [pic] [pic] A barong Tagalog held against the light‚ showing the translucency of the fabric. [pic] [pic] The barong Tagalog (with Mandarin collar) The barong Tagalog (or simply barong) is an embroidered formal garment of thePhilippines. It is very lightweight and worn untucked (similar to a coat/dress shirt)‚ over an undershirt. In Filipino culture it is a common wedding and formal attire‚ mostly for men but also for women.
